Wisconsin Conservation Voters condemns Trump’s latest attack on Wisconsin’s environment and future

 

By - Apr 10th, 2025 04:30 pm

MADISON – President Trump’s sweeping anti-climate Executive Order issued Tuesday is a dangerous, unconstitutional attack on Wisconsin’s right to lead on clean energy, climate resilience, and environmental justice. Wisconsin Conservation Voters condemns this dangerous and extreme move that threatens the health, safety, and future of our state and its people.

This Executive Order is an assault on state sovereignty, local leadership, and the will of the people. Wisconsin is building a future rooted in clean air, clean water, and affordable, renewable energy that creates thousands of good-paying jobs across both rural and urban communities. This order is a brazen attack on progress, public health, and our state’s future.

“This is one of the most extreme and reckless attacks on Wisconsin’s future we’ve ever seen,” said Executive Director Kerry Schumann. “It’s not just an assault on clean energy – it’s an assault on our right to protect our communities, our economy, our health, and our environment. Wisconsinites won’t be bullied into propping up out-of-state fossil fuels. We will keep fighting for a cleaner, safer, and more affordable future.”

Trump’s order would force Wisconsin to rely on expensive, outdated, out-of-state, dangerous fossil fuels – rolling back hard-won progress, threatening lives, and driving up costs for families and businesses alike. It’s a giveaway to Big Oil and coal CEOs at the expense of Wisconsin communities.

The climate crisis is already hitting home – from historic floods, to choking algae blooms in our lakes, to extreme heat threatening the health and safety of our cities and farms. Climate change is harming the health of Wisconsinites. Rising temperatures are driving more heat-related illnesses, while worsening air quality is triggering asthma and heart disease. Flooding and extreme weather are causing injuries and trauma, and warmer conditions are spreading tick- and mosquito-borne diseases like Lyme and West Nile. These threats are growing – and they demand urgent action. Now is the time to lead, not to be dragged backward by an extremist federal administration.

Wisconsin Conservation Voters stands with everyone defending the right to chart our own clean energy future. This is more than a policy dispute – it’s a fight for Wisconsin’s economy, environment, public health, and democracy.

The best way to fight back is to keep moving forward – with bold local action, state leadership, and the power of Wisconsin voters behind us. The path ahead is clear – we choose clean energy, local jobs, and a safer climate for all.

“We’re already working alongside partners across the country and in Washington, D.C., to build strong defenses against these craven attacks – because this isn’t just about policy, it’s about power,” Schumann said. “This Executive Order is designed to make the richest people in the world even richer while stripping communities of the tools they need to build a healthier, safer, and more equitable future. We will not let that stand. Together, we’re pushing back and we’re moving forward.”
